Kevin Costner stars in and directs the
Western Open Range.
Robert Duvall stars as
Boss Spearman, a rugged old-timer who free-grazes cattle. He and
Charley Waite (
Costner) have been partners for ten years. As the film opens in the 1880s, the pair and their employees -- the beefy, rugged, likable
Mose (
Abraham Benrubi) and the impetuous Mexican teenager
Buttons (
Diego Luna) -- are driving cattle across the West.
Mose is attacked and thrown in jail during a visit to a town. The local cattle rancher
Baxter (
Michael Gambon) wants the free grazers off his land and warns
Charley and
Boss when they retrieve
Mose that they have until the next day to be out of the area.
Boss decides to fight back, especially after
Baxter's men do harm to the foursome.
Charley confesses his past as a killer during the Civil War and strikes up a tentative romance with
Sue Barlow -- the sister of the town doctor. The film's centerpiece is an extended gunfight between the duo (with some assistance from sympathetic townsfolk) and
Baxter's hired gunmen. ~ Perry Seibert, All Movie Guide
